Output 51bc409aaa338743f68834db49044a1f4c80d72d6dfb849ee9d7212ac6033a5a:9

value
2578115
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4860e977e53bdaff7324a9f6997d42f33964943 OP_EQUALVERIFY OP_CHECKSIG
address
1PHvUFWif4TxHPg1xU2bW76QuoXgr4MJ6r
transaction
51bc409aaa338743f68834db49044a1f4c80d72d6dfb849ee9d7212ac6033a5a
spent
true